Le Tour de Campus at Alfred U.
The wheels of innovation are turning at Alfred University. This month the admissions office introduced a new way to take the campus tour: on a bicycle built for seven.
Student tour guides get to steer the 14-pedaled contraption, which was made by a Dutch company called Conference Bike. The machine cost Alfred about $8,750, a small price to pay for such a unique experience, says Jodi S. Bailey, the university's director of marketing.
